The Bee Hive - Sterling II is an assisted-living facility located in Sterling, Colorado. This facility is designed to support residents who may require assistance with daily activities while promoting as much independence as possible. It provides a range of services and amenities aimed at enhancing the quality of life for its residents, ensuring they receive appropriate care in a comfortable setting.
At The Bee Hive - Sterling II, residents have access to various clubs and communities that encourage social interaction and engagement. These provide opportunities for residents to partake in group activities and foster connections with fellow residents, contributing to an active and socially fulfilling environment. Physical therapy services are also available, tailored to meet the individual needs of residents to help them maintain or improve their physical function. This is an important aspect of care for many residents, supporting mobility and overall well-being.
The facility is staffed with nurses who provide medical support and assistance with health-related needs, ensuring residents have access to essential healthcare services. In addition, The Bee Hive offers laundry and dry cleaning services, aiding residents in maintaining their personal hygiene and clothing cleanliness effortlessly. For grooming services, there is an on-site barber and beauty salon, allowing residents to attend to their personal presentation in a convenient and comfortable setting.
Recent reviews of The Bee Hive - Sterling II have highlighted differing experiences, particularly surrounding the impact of leadership changes. Under former manager Leeann, the facility was noted for its caring atmosphere and attentive, engaging staff. The environment was described as clean and calm, with a responsive staff that added to a home-like feel. With the advent of new management under Trish, however, there seems to be a shift in the perceived quality of care and the warmth of staff interactions. Reports indicate that some families have expressed concerns over an increasing lack of organization and engagement from the staff, prompting reconsideration of their previously positive assessments. This illustrates the substantial role management plays in shaping resident experiences and the reputation of the facility.
Costs at this community start at $2,554 and range up to $9,247. The average price in the community is $5,900, which is less than the average price in the area of $6,427. The cost of assisted living in this area is essentially the same as the cost throughout the state. If the resident needs other services, additional services may increase the monthly cost.
